On a 1989 Oldsmobile Cutlass, the voltage regulator is typically integrated into the alternator itself. To access it, you would need to locate the alternator, which is usually mounted on the front of the engine. If the voltage regulator is separate, it can often be found mounted on or near the firewall or fender well. Always consult the vehicle's service manual for specific details related to your model.
